Seventh Annual Walk for a New Spring

A Walk from Boston to Washington, DC

Jan 6 – Feb 15, 2008

Walk for a New Spring will begin its annual walk from the New England Peace Pagoda in Leverett, MA on Sunday, January 6, 2008 and walk locally to the Leverett Congregational Church where we will join the Sunday service. This year, the 40 day walk will begin its first full day in Boston on Monday, January 7, 2008 and will end in Washington, DC on Friday, February 15, 2008.

The Walk for a New Spring is initiated by Nipponzan Myohoji, a Japanese Buddhist Order that builds pagodas around the world and initiates walks for peace. They state that, “Just as the generosity of Mother earth does not fail to bring forth Spring out of Winter, we walk believing that we ordinary people can bring forth the power of peace and equity both within our daily lives locally and within the governmental power structure. We walk for an awakening of conscience, of desiring to do good and putting down harmful actions, believing and esteeming that seed of pure divinity within all people, even those who do much harm”.

In the towns and cities Walk participants will talk to mayors about the international organization, Mayors for Peace. Mayors for Peace was created 25 years ago by the Mayors of Hiroshima and Nagasaki to help other cities avoid the tragedy they faced in 1945 with the dropping of atomic bombs in Japan. Currently there are more than 1700 mayors world-wide that have joined Mayors for Peace. The goal is to completely eliminate all nuclear weapons by the year 2020.
